The key to effectively feeding your animals in an intensive farming system, is the percentage of digestible crude protein (DCP) contained in their feed
Where livestock (poultry, and ruminants) are raised in a free range manner, they get their DCP from foraging on the ground

Another reason why soybeans isn't in greater supply in the market is because it needs to be processed before consumption
Soybeans is an oilseed with about 50% oil content
The seed contains about 25% & 20% of protein & carbohydrates respectively,
While the rest are minor

If you feed your animal with a mix of soybeans which hasn't been de-oiled, you will need to include far more in the mixture before you can achieve a good DCP content
For example, if you want to produce a 50kg bag of feed with minimum DCP of 20%,

You will need to make almost 90% of the feed mixture to be full fat soybeans alone.
On the other, when you extract the oil in the soybeans and roast it (to kill the inhibitors that don't allow it to be eaten raw),
You have a 50% protein content and 40% carbohydrate content

Therefore you will only need 20kg of soybean meal (de-oiled soybeans) in a 50kg bag of animal feed to arrive at a 20% DCP ratio
Several sources of carbohydrate also contain DCP (such as maize with 8% DCP)
Maize is favored by feed producers because it allows them to use less

soybeans per feed mix.
Maize yield per hectare in the developed world is between 4 and 12 tons, while soybeans yield is 2.8 tons
In Nigeria, maize yield is between 2 and 8 tons per hectare, while soybeans still hovers between 0.8 and 1.6 tons
Therefore it is cheaper to import
